Russian army makes great strides in Kursk and Donbas

Công LuậnCông Luận14/12/2024

(CLO) Russian troops have liberated several communities in the Ukrainian-held Kursk region, as well as made significant advances in the Donbas region over the past week, according to the Russian Defense Ministry on Friday.


Specifically, the TASS news agency quoted a statement saying: "During the week, units of the Northern Combat Group continued to destroy Ukrainian armed formations on the territory of the Kursk Region. They liberated the settlements of Plekhovo, Daryino, and Novoivanovka in the Kursk Region…," as well as gaining control of the settlements of Zhyoltoye, Berestki, and Zarya in Donetsk, Ukraine.

In addition, in response to Ukraine's ATACMS missile attack on a military airfield in Taganrog, the Russian military launched a precision strike on major Ukrainian fuel and energy facilities supporting its defense industry, according to the Russian Ministry of Defense.

According to the statement, the attack was carried out with the support of high-precision, long-range air and sea weapons, as well as attack drones. The airstrike was successful, hitting all designated facilities.

Earlier, the Russian Ministry of Defense reported on Wednesday that Ukraine had launched a missile attack using Western long-range weapons on the Taganrog military airfield in the Rostov Region on the morning of December 11, 2024.

The statement said it confirmed that six US-made ATACMS ballistic missiles were involved in the attack. The missiles were shot down by air defenses, and although the ATACMS missile debris did not cause significant damage, some casualties were reported.

Meanwhile,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y said this was one of the biggest Russian attacks ever on Ukraine's struggling power grid and proof of why Kyiv needs more support from the West.

The national grid operator said Russia's 12th major attack on the power system this year has damaged power facilities in several regions of Ukraine and forced authorities to impose even longer power cuts on millions of the country's citizens.
